Lovely location, but a bit tired
Electric hardstanding touring pitch
Liked The site is easily accessed along reasonably sized roads, so no squeezing down small lanes. Its situated in beautiful surroundings and a footpath runs at the bottom of the site do its super easy to get out walking. The pitches are reasonably level and OK to access. Although I do wonder how easy it would be when busy as there isn't a huge amount of room.
Pub is conveniently located at the entrance to the site and was ok, if dated.
Disliked The toilets are centrally located but aren't the best. Toilet roll holders and locks are broken off the two male toilets that were open and the floor was dirty. Showers were alright though.
There is one place for emptying grey water and its right at the sink for washing-up so you have to time your trip well to avoid people. Only one water fill point and that's centrally placed with the washing up sink.
